It's Carnival season in Trinidad, and songstress Mya made her way to the island to join in on the festivities. The singer posted photos of her Carnival fit on Instagram and the golden-winged and crowned ensemble made her fans' jaws drop. "Thank you Trinidad!," Mya wrote on Instagram. "Nothin‘ but love, joy, peace, good music & fun in the sun!" However, Mya wasn't the only one enjoying the party. Both Lil Kim and TLC's Chilli were living their best lives in Trinidad, as well.

The three ladies are reportedly filming a show titled Girls Crew and have been spotted throughout the Caribbean taking in the sights. Recently, paparazzi caught them on the beach while filming in Barbados, just one of many stops for the forthcoming VH1 show. As of now, there has yet to be a premiere date, but it looks to be a reality show adventure for the three artists.

Meanwhile, Mya may have opted for a gold look, but Chilli decided to go with a bold, feathered red 'fit. She posted a clip on Instagram of herself giving fans a 360 look, twirling around on a yacht with an ocean background. Lil Kim' elaborate, feathered headpiece was a show stopper as she danced for the cameras.
